EPDM roof inspection services involve a thorough assessment of rubber roofing systems commonly used on commercial buildings, residential flat roofs, and other structures with rubber membrane surfaces. These inspections typically include a detailed visual examination of the entire roof surface, checking for signs of wear, damage, or deterioration. Service providers may also use specialized tools to identify issues that are not immediately visible, such as leaks or compromised seams. Regular inspections help property owners detect potential problems early, preventing small issues from developing into costly repairs or full roof replacements.
One of the primary benefits of EPDM roof inspections is identifying common problems like cracks, punctures, or tears in the rubber membrane. Over time, exposure to weather elements can cause the material to weaken or develop leaks, which may lead to water damage inside the building. Inspections can also reveal issues with flashing, seams, or drainage systems that might cause water pooling or infiltration. Addressing these problems promptly can extend the lifespan of the roof and maintain the building’s integrity, ensuring it remains protected against the elements.

The overview below groups typical Epdm Roof Inspection proj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Cranston, RI.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or EPDM roof inspections in Cranston often range from $250 to $600. Many routine inspections and small repairs fall within this middle tier, depending on the roof size and complexity.
Moderate Projects - Larger inspections or repairs, such as addressing multiple leaks or surface issues, usually cost between $600 and $1,200. Many local contractors handle these projects within this range, though costs can vary based on specific needs.
Extensive Repairs - For more involved work like extensive membrane patching or partial replacements, costs generally range from $1,200 to $3,000. These projects are less common but can be necessary for older or heavily damaged roofs.
Full Replacement - Complete EPDM roof replacements in Cranston can typically cost $5,000 or more, especially for larger or complex roofs. While fewer projects reach this level, local service providers can handle these larger-scale jobs when needed.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is involved in an EPDM roof inspection? An EPDM roof inspection typically includes checking for membrane damage, seams, flashing, and drainage issues to assess the roof's condition and identify potential problems.
How often should EPDM roofs be inspected? It is recommended to have EPDM roofs inspected at least once a year and after severe weather events to ensure their integrity and longevity.
What signs indicate that an EPDM roof needs repair? Visible signs such as cracks, blisters, ponding water, or seam separations can indicate that an EPDM roof requires repair or further evaluation by a professional.
